Default Image

Months format

Show More Text

Load More

Related Posts Widget

Article Navigation

Contact Us Form


Sorry, the page you were looking for in this blog does not exist. Back Home

5 Best Practices in Mobile App Development in 2023

    The mobile app development market is still a rather young one as it has been developing for around two decades. The approaches to building apps are continuously evolving amid the introduction of new tools and technologies. End users are becoming more demanding while businesses expect to get more and more feature-rich and powerful solutions that will address their needs. All this has a direct impact on the ways and methods applied by developers.

    Mobile App Development

    According to Statista, the number of smartphone users is around 6.8 billion worldwide. It means that nearly 86% of all the people on our planet have smartphones and, consequently, use mobile apps in solving their business and everyday tasks. 

    The growing number of smartphone users results in an increase in the demand for mobile software solutions and their diversification. If you have a look at the mobile products built by software development companies, for example, Cogniteq app developers, you will see that practically all industries now have their solutions. But what helps companies to make their products successful? What are the best practices in the development of mobile solutions in 2023? 

    Increased attention to user experience

    When you are building a mobile application, first of all, you should think about the people who will use it. You always need to have a very good understanding of when and how they will interact with your solution. It will help you to make this interaction as comfortable for them as possible. 

    You and your development team should bear in mind such factors as convenience of navigation, speed of getting the desired results, and general impressions of using the application. Today the expectations are rather high which means that your app should look and feel equally good. That’s why you need to allocate reasonable investments for launching a top-notch application.

    Focus on security

    Hackers now have extremely sophisticated tools that allow them to get access to users’ sensitive data and financial assets even on the most prominent platforms. But this fact shouldn’t be a reason for you to give up. Vice versa it should motivate you to look for new ways to protect your application and to make security one of the main priorities from the very start of your project realization. For example, among the most widely-applied tools used to protect access to the app, we should mention two-factor authentication. 

    Timely updates

    If you have ever analyzed the range of services provided by full-cycle software development teams, you’ve probably seen that post-launch support and maintenance are always on the list. And it is a very good approach. It is impossible just to release an application and forget about it. You should regularly work on the improvements for it, monitor its performance, update its content, and introduce new features. It will be a good idea to plan these updates in advance so that you will be able to better control your budget.

    Obligatory testing

    Testing and debugging have crucial importance for your app's success. Even if you have the best solution ever and users desperately want to have access to its features, its poor performance, failures, downtimes, and other issues will motivate people to start looking for a better alternative.

    That’s why professional development teams always apply several types of tests, including manual and automated testing. While some types of these tests are conducted in parallel with the development process in order to detect bugs and fix them as soon as possible, it is required to test your app once again when everything is ready. This procedure is usually called regression testing and it is aimed at checking all the functionality after all the changes are already introduced.

    App store guidelines

    App marketplaces are platforms where you can publish your app to make it available to users. These platforms usually pay a lot of attention to their reputation and do their best to attentively monitor the quality of the applications that are being placed on them. You can’t publish your app without getting approval from the platform. Your submission can be declined and you will need to introduce a row of changes that will make your app compliant with the existing rules. But it is always better to be prepared in advance. It won’t be challenging to find the Apple Developer Program guideline or the Android app development guide and analyze all the provided rules and best practices before starting to build your own solution.


    The demand for mobile applications is not going to fall. With the growing smartphone penetration, we can even expect to observe a new wave of its increase. It means that new apps are still kindly welcomed in the market. Nevertheless, you should not forget about tough market competition. There are a lot of similar solutions and you need to make your app unique and highly reliable to stand out from the crowd.

    No comments:

    Post a Comment